Major radar changes require 'illuminators' to support Evolved Sea Sparrow Missiles in protecting carriers. The USS John F. Kennedy, a future Ford-class carrier, is bringing back a key feature from the Nimitz-class. This change aims to enhance the missile's effectiveness.
The integration of 'illuminators' with Evolved Sea Sparrow Missiles is crucial for the defense of carriers, highlighting the importance of adaptive radar technologies in naval warfare.
